Abstract excerpt
Gsp oncogenes are present in about 40% of somatotropinomas. They result in excessive cAMP production and have been proposed to be the cause of increased GH secretion. We have used in vitro cell culture to compare the biochemical characteristics of somatotropinomas with and without gsp oncogenes (gsp-positive and gsp-negative tumors, respectively).
